The Hidden Iodine Crisis and Cognitive Risks
Iodine levels are frequently overlooked in standard screenings performed in local offices. Most salt in processed foods lacks this vital mineral that drives thyroid function. The World Health Organization has long identified iodine deficiency as a leading preventable cause of impaired childhood cognitive development, a tragedy that costs families dearly later.
The connection between maternal choline intake and lifelong brain health-specifically the development of the hippocampus-has become a focal point for researchers who argue that current federal guidelines, which were last updated decades ago, fail to account for the neuroprotective benefits of higher dosages. Recent studies confirm the gap.
While folate is widely recognized for preventing neural tube defects-the timing of education remains the primary failure point because most women do not start supplementation until after the window of maximum benefit has closed. Many start too late. Clinicians note that education often occurs only after a positive test.

Anemia affects more than a third of pregnancies worldwide, by World Health Organization estimates, and iron deficiency grows most common in the third trimester. This condition-which increases the risk of postpartum hemorrhage and low birth weight-is often preventable through the strategic pairing of iron-rich foods with vitamin C to maximize absorption in the small intestine. Science supports this simple shift.

Calcium needs increase significantly as the fetal skeleton begins to ossify in the second trimester. If the diet lacks these minerals, the body will literally dissolve its own bone tissue to provide for the baby-a process that can lead to dental issues and early-onset osteoporosis for the mother. The bodily structure must be protected.

Optimizing Maternal Nutrition
1 Request a Nutrient PanelAsk a provider for specific blood tests for iron, vitamin D, and iodine levels early in the first trimester.
2 Review Choline ContentCheck the prenatal supplement for choline, aiming for 450mg to 550mg daily through a mix of pills and whole foods.
3 Track Protein IntakeLog daily meals for three days to ensure the intake reaches at least 75 grams of protein to support tissue growth.
Pro Tip: Always consume an iron supplement with a glass of orange juice or a piece of citrus fruit, as vitamin C can double the absorption rate of non-heme iron sources.
